Web13 de abr. de 2024 · Most tickets more than 15mph over the speed limit are charged as misdemeanors. These speeding tickets, if you are convicted can result in license and insurance points, revocation of your driver’s license, and probation or even jail time if you charge with a high-speed offense. Web31 de ago. de 2024 · SMITHFIELD, N.C. (WNCN) – Some North Carolina drivers are now able to argue down a speeding ticket without going to court or hiring a lawyer. It’s part of a new pilot program offered by the state. Johnston County is one of five counties who currently use it and it’s expected to be rolled out statewide in late September.
